What is Mocha Mousse Hair?

Mocha mousse hair is a smooth, multi-dimensional brunette blend inspired by the comforting tones of coffee and chocolate. It merges deep, cool mocha bases with lighter, whipped-toffee highlights that catch the light without overpowering the overall tone.

Unlike flat single-process browns, mocha mousse is all about depth and balance. It's creamy yet cool, rich yet reflective—sitting right between ash brown and warm espresso. The result is a velvety finish that enhances natural movement and shine, perfect for those craving a sophisticated but low-maintenance colour.

Who Does Mocha Mousse Suit?

Fair to medium skins benefit from golden or toffee-infused mocha, which adds warmth and glow. Olive and deeper tones often pair beautifully with cooler, ashier variations that enhance natural contrast. Blondes going darker can use mocha mousse as a soft transition shade—it's rich without feeling overpowering. Brunettes wanting dimension will love how babylights or soft balayage lift and illuminate their existing tone.

How It's Achieved in the Salon

The artistry behind mocha mousse hair lies in precision and layering. It's not a single-process colour—it's a crafted fusion of tones, techniques, and glazing.

Depending on your starting base, stylists create buttery ribbons using balayage for a sun-kissed sweep or babylights for finer, more diffused illumination. These lighter elements form the "mousse" warmth against the mocha base. After the lift, a gloss toner is applied to harmonise the shades—this is where the magic happens. The gloss not only neutralises brassy tones but gives the hair a mirror-like sheen reminiscent of a silky chocolate mousse. Finally, a rich conditioning treatment seals in moisture and protects the cuticle, ensuring your hair stays silky and soft.

At-Home Care for Mocha Mousse Hair

Use a sulphate-free shampoo to preserve the richness of your tone and prevent fading. Incorporate colour-safe conditioning masks weekly to maintain shine and hydration. Protect with heat spray—the gloss looks its best when your hair's cuticle stays smooth. Refresh your gloss between visits with a quick in-salon toning appointment to revive the reflection without recolouring.

A professional tip: slightly cooler water and gentle blow-drying techniques prolong the vibrancy of brunette shades beautifully.
